ECharts と Java インターフェイス: インテリジェント製造の分野で統計分析を適用する方法

WBOY
リリース: 2023-12-17 16:38:21
オリジナル
1031 人が閲覧しました

ECharts と Java インターフェイス: インテリジェント製造の分野で統計分析を適用する方法

ECharts と Java インターフェイス: インテリジェント マニュファクチャリングの分野で統計分析を適用する方法。具体的なコード例が必要です。

インテリジェント マニュファクチャリングは、今日の製造業の重要な開発方向です。先進技術と情報技術を活用して、生産効率、品質、柔軟性を向上させます。統計分析はインテリジェント製造に不可欠な部分であり、企業が生産プロセスを監視して最適化するのに役立ちます。この記事では、ECharts と Java インターフェイスを使用してインテリジェント マニュファクチャリングの分野で統計分析を実行する方法と、具体的なコード例を紹介します。

ECharts は、JavaScript をベースにしたオープン ソースの視覚化ライブラリであり、豊富なグラフ タイプと対話型関数を提供し、ユーザーがさまざまなグラフを迅速に作成できるようにします。 Java はエンタープライズ レベルのアプリケーション開発で広く使用されているプログラミング言語であり、データを処理して分析を実行するための豊富なライブラリとツールを備えています。 ECharts と Java インターフェイスを組み合わせることで、インテリジェント製造分野でさまざまな統計分析を実行し、企業により良い意思決定の基盤を提供できます。

まず、データを取得して Java で処理する必要があります。温度、湿度、圧力など、生産プロセスのさまざまなデータをリアルタイムで収集して保存できるインテリジェントな製造システムがあるとします。 Java のデータベース接続ライブラリを使用してデータベースに接続し、SQL ステートメントを記述して必要なデータを取得できます。以下は、温度データを取得するためのサンプル コードです。

import java.sql.*;

public class DataAnalysis {
    public static void main(String[] args) {
        try {
            // 连接数据库
            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/production", "username", "password");
            
            // 执行SQL语句获取温度数据
            Statement stmt = conn.createStatement();
            String sql = "SELECT temperature FROM production_data WHERE production_line = 'A'";
            ResultSet rs = stmt.executeQuery(sql);
            
            // 处理数据
            while (rs.next()) {
                double temperature = rs.getDouble("temperature");
                // 对数据进行统计分析或其他处理
            }
            
            // 关闭数据库连接
            rs.close();
            stmt.close();
            conn.close();
        } catch (SQLException e) {
            e.printStackTrace();
        }
    }
}
ログイン後にコピー

上記のコードを通じて、データベースから温度データを取得し、さらなる統計分析やその他の処理を実行できます。次に、データを ECharts で必要な形式に変換し、視覚的な表示に ECharts を使用する必要があります。以下は、温度データを ECharts で必要な JSON 形式に変換し、ヒストグラムで表示するサンプル コードです。

import com.github.abel533.echarts.Option;
import com.github.abel533.echarts.axis.CategoryAxis;
import com.github.abel533.echarts.code.Magic;

public class DataVisualization {
    public static void main(String[] args) {
        // 创建Option对象
        Option option = new Option();
        
        // 创建X轴和Y轴
        CategoryAxis xAxis = new CategoryAxis();
        xAxis.setName("时间");
        xAxis.setData(new String[]{"09:00", "09:10", "09:20", "09:30", "09:40"});
        option.xAxis(xAxis);
        
        com.github.abel533.echarts.axis.ValueAxis yAxis = new com.github.abel533.echarts.axis.ValueAxis();
        yAxis.setName("温度");
        yAxis.setMax(100);
        option.yAxis(yAxis);
        
        // 添加数据
        option.series(Magic.bar, new com.github.abel533.echarts.series.Bar().setData(new int[]{20, 30, 40, 50, 60}));
        
        // 输出JSON格式
        System.out.println(option.toString());
    }
}
ログイン後にコピー

上記のコードにより、温度データを ECharts で必要な JSON 形式に変換し、ヒストグラムで表示することができます。コンソールに JSON 文字列が出力されます。この文字列は、チャートの描画と対話に ECharts ライブラリを使用して、フロントエンド ページの js コードで直接使用できます。

要約すると、この記事では、ECharts と Java インターフェイスをインテリジェント製造分野の統計分析に適用する方法を紹介し、具体的なコード例を示します。 ECharts と Java を組み合わせることで、データを簡単に処理して視覚化でき、インテリジェントな製造に対するより適切な意思決定のサポートを提供できます。この記事が、インテリジェント製造分野における統計分析の読者の役に立てば幸いです。

以上がECharts と Java インターフェイス: インテリジェント製造の分野で統計分析を適用する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ート